- BIOL-232 - ANATOMY AND PHYSIOLOGY 2 4 credits
- A continuation of Anatomy & Physiology 1 concentrating on circulatory, respiratory, digestive, urinary, endocrine, and reproductive systems. Laboratory sessions are included. Emphasis is placed on association, correlation, critical thinking and overview of the body as a whole. Three lecture and two lab hours. PREREQUISITE: Anatomy & Physiology 1 (BIOL-132) with a C- or better. Honors component available.
